[BBC News] Plans to build the world’s largest offshore wind farm off the coast of North Devon are being unveiled. If it goes ahead the [GBP] 3bn Atlantic Array scheme will have 350 turbines … The power from the wind farm would be transmitted to shore via submarine cables and then via underground cables into the existing National Grid substation at Alverdiscott.
